Top 5 Fish Games Performance in Peru for Q2 2023
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 fish games in Peru for Q2 2023,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the second quarter of 2023, the top 5 fish games in Peru demonstrated varied performance trends across we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Data from Sensor Tower reveals insightful metrics for each of these popular games.
Fishdom from Playrix experienced a steady increase in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$8K in mid-April before tapering off to around $6.5K by the end of June. Weekly downloads saw a notable rise mid-quarter, reaching nearly 17.3K in the final week of June. Active users fluctuated slightly but remained robust, closing the quarter at approximately 71.9K.
Fishdom Solitaire, also from Playrix, saw weekly revenue peak at around $1.1K in mid-May. Downloads, however, showed a downward trend, starting at 2.5K in late March and dropping to just over 500 by the end of June. Active users followed a similar decline, ending the quarter at approximately 2.7K.
Hungry Shark Evolution from Ubisoft displayed consistent weekly revenue, averaging around $200 with minor fluctuations. Weekly downloads spiked significantly at the end of May, reaching over 21K, while active users saw a peak in the same period at approximately 102.9K, before settling at around 71.1K by the end of June.
Hungry Shark World, another title from Ubisoft, had a relatively stable revenue stream, peaking at $223 in late May. Downloads saw moderate fluctuations, averaging around 2.5K throughout the quarter. Active users remained steady, hovering around 22K to 27K.
Tap Tap Fish - AbyssRium, published by SangHeon Kim, showed minimal revenue and no significant download activity. Weekly revenue peaked briefly at $101 in early April but generally remained below $100. There were no notable active user metrics provided for this game.
